Best Schools in Texanna, OK
Texanna, OK has a total of 13 schools including 5 high schools, 5 middle schools and 3 elementary schools. A total of 4,248 students attend Texanna, OK schools. On average, schools in Texanna score 22%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 20%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Texanna ex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Texanna, OK
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
Texanna, OK has a total population of 3,463 with 17%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 87%, and 16%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
